Alberta continues to struggle with public health messaging to young adults
Description
August 26, 2020
Younger Albertans made up the majority of new cases in the province from Aug. 18 to 24. The government is pleading with them to take the coronavirus seriously but there are concerns that the messaging may be falling on deaf ears. Julia Wong explains.
